Independent School students, sometime in the late 1920s.

Front row: Roberta McKinley, Mildred Myers, Helen Myers, Dorothy Lehew, Eloise McKinley, Stella Mae Carothers, Virginia Lehew.

Back row: ? Kirby, Walter W. McKinley, ? Kirby, Teacher-Mrs. Ruth Thomas, ? Beimford, Frances Myers.

Independence School District #33 was 1.5 miles east of Forsyth on the south side of County Highway 20. The school opened prior to 1880 and was formed to stay "independent" of the Forsyth school.

Independence School closed in 1940.
